Kifaa cha kukatiza mzunguko
5.1 Kiambatisho cha ndani
5.1.1 Utoaji wa Shunt
Mchoro wa muunganisho, tazama Mchoro 1 na Mchoro 2.
Volti ya umeme wa kudhibiti iliyokadiriwa: AC 50/60Hz, 230V, 400V; DC24V, kivunja mzunguko kinaweza kufanya kazi kwa uaminifu chini ya 85% hadi 110% ya voltage ya umeme wa kudhibiti iliyokadiriwa.
5.12 Utoaji wa chini ya volteji
Wakati volteji iko chini ya 35% ya volteji ya nguvu ya udhibiti iliyokadiriwa, kutolewa huku kunaweza kuzuia kivunja mzunguko dhidi ya kufunga. Mchoro wa muunganisho, tazama Mchoro 3.
Wakati volteji inapopungua hadi kiwango cha 70% hadi 35% ya volteji ya nguvu ya udhibiti iliyokadiriwa, kutolewa kwa volteji isiyo na volteji kungeanguka.
Wakati volteji iko katika kiwango cha 85% hadi 110% ya volteji ya nguvu ya udhibiti iliyokadiriwa, kutolewa huku kunaweza kuhakikisha kipimo cha saketi kinafanywa kwa uhakika.
Taarifa: Kivunja mzunguko chenye uondoaji wa chini ya volteji kinaweza kujikwaa na kufunga, kilimpa kivunja mzunguko volteji iliyokadiriwa pekee.

5.15 Vifaa maalum vya kivunja mzunguko vya mita ya kulipia kabla
Utoaji wa shunt wa volteji ya uendeshaji yenye kipimo cha Mita ya kulipia kabla ni AC230V 50Hz, Inafanya kazi katika kiwango cha 65% hadi 110% Ue, wakati sehemu ya Ctrl imefunguliwa, kivunja mzunguko kitavunjika baada ya sekunde 0.5 hadi sekunde 2. Tazama Mchoro:
5.16 Kivunja mzunguko wa volteji nyingi
Kivunja mzunguko wa volteji nyingi kinapaswa kukwama chini ya hali zifuatazo:
a) Wakati voltage ya uendeshaji iliyokadiriwa (voltage ya awamu) iko chini ya 262V
b) Wakati mstari usio na upande wowote wa awamu tatu na waya nne unavunjika
c) Wakati mstari usio na upande wowote unapounganisha mistari ya awamu vibaya,
